The waterfall was good, but it was little isolated and wasn't easy to reach. The was one shop located at the waterfall where we had some snacks and tea. While coming from Galu Devi temple to
Mcleodganj, it started raining like cats and dogs. Though we had raincoats, but they weren't working due to heavy rain. In just 5 minutes of rain, we got completely drenched. We decided to take a halt in the shelter and wait for the rain to slow down. At around 4 PM, we reached Mcleodganj, changed our clothes and did our lunch at a restaurant. As it was raining, we couldn't explore the markets of Mcleodganj. We booked our bus from the Mcleodganj bus stand and at 6 pm, our bus left from Mcleodganj and arrived Delhi at 5 am. The return journey was good and relaxing. Also made one friend named Liat from the USA, who was also coming from Triund.
